In 2021, the New Mexico State Legislature amended the Local Economic Development Act (LEDA),through the adoption of Senate Bill 49, to allow municipalities to use municipal funding for retail businesses in their communities.

 

The 2024 National Community Survey results continue to confirm the resident's desires for more downtown vitality. Retail gap data show food services, clothing and health/personal care stores as top retail gaps along with gas stations (Attachment B).

 

Staff will present a proposal (Attachment A) to initiate a new LEDA for Retail program and discuss the goals, criteria, steps and timelines.
